利用props在子组件接受父组件传过来的值1.父组件parentComp.vue 2.子组件childComp.vue 3.路由文件index.js 在浏览器地址栏输入:http://localhost:[port ...
在一个vue页面中有时候内容会很多,为了方便编写查看,可以分为多个子组件,最后在父组件中引入对应的子组件即可。 下面这个是父子组件通信中的一个具体实例:新增 修改弹框。子组件中主要写了关于新增 修改的弹框, 子组件: .弹框: lt div class newDocuments gt lt div class newDocuments center gt lt div class center h ...
2019-10-14 19:41 0 554 推荐指数:
利用props在子组件接受父组件传过来的值1.父组件parentComp.vue 2.子组件childComp.vue 3.路由文件index.js 在浏览器地址栏输入:http://localhost:[port ...
组件之间的通信分为2种 父子组件之间的通信 非父子组件之间的通信 父组件向子组件传数据 如果要传递多个数据,使用多个属性即可。 子组件向父组件传数据 @事件='',事件可以是预定义的,也可以是自定义 ...
实现非父子组件之间的通信,有以下几种方式 Bus总线。创建一个空的Vue对象作为Bus中央事件总线(中间组件)。 vuex(适合大型项目,小项目效果不明显) provide/inject(同根往下派发) 本地存储 第一种是最常用的,此处只介绍第一种 ...
一、新增1、新增按钮2、新增事件 在methods中,用来打开弹窗,dialogVisible在data中定义使用有true或false来控制显示弹框 **3、新增确定,弹框确定事件 ,新增和修改共用一个确定事件,使用id区别 **3、新增事件调新增接口,判断是否有id,没有就调新增接口 ...
注意:1. vue组件间的通信其实有很多种方法,最常用的还是属性传值、事件传值、vuex; 其他方法参考 https://juejin.im/post/5bd18c72e51d455e3f6e4334?utm_medium=hao.caibaojian.com& ...
通信方式: > props(常用) > props和$emit(常用) > .sync(语法糖) > model(单选框和复选框场景可以使用) > $attr和$listeners(组件封装用的比较多) > provide和inject ...
父子组件之间可以通过props进行通信: 组件的定义: 1.创建component类: var Profile = Vue.extend({ template: "< ...